Chicago: Extensive cloudiness. Lake-effect rain showers, some may reach as far as 30-40 miles inland this morning. But lake rains shift east to Indiana and diminish, allowing clouds to break and sunshine to increase by afternoon. An 8th straight sub-60 (degrees) day. Clearing, frosty and cool Thursday night. Local upper 20s inland.
HIGH: 52
LOW: 33
LAKE EFFECT RAINS TO EASE
